  • Tax on bifacial solar panels

    Tax on bifacial solar panels

    According to PV Magazine, the federal trade authorities have now ruled that bifacial solar modules are no longer subject to the Section 201 ruling, which would apply 25% tariff to majority of solar modules imported.


    FAQs about Tax on bifacial solar panels

    Are bifacial solar panels exempt from tariffs?

    Bifacial solar panels, which are predominantly used in commercial, industrial, and utility-scale solar power projects, were previously exempt from tariffs. With the removal of this exemption, the cost of imported bifacial solar panels, typically ranging from $0.10-0.25 per watt, will increase by $0.015 to $0.0375 per watt.

    Will bifacial solar panels lose exemption?

    In addition to bifacial panels losing their exemption, the Biden Administration said it will raise the tariff-rate quota (TRQ) of silicon solar cells by 7.5 GW, if needed.

    Will bifacial solar panels be exempt from Section 201 duties?

    President Biden issued Proclamation 10779, ending the exemption from Section 201 duties on bifacial solar panels imported on or after June 26. Find out if your products are affected.

    Did Biden put bifacial solar panels back under Sec 201 tariffs?

    The Biden Administration today put imported bifacial solar panels back under Sec. 201 tariffs, after the specialty solar panels enjoyed a two-year exemption from extra duties first initiated by President Biden in 2022.

    When can I import bifacial solar panels?

    The affected solar cells and modules are classified under the following Harmonized Tariff Schedule (HTS) codes: Importers who signed contracts by May 16, 2024, may import bifacial solar panels without Section 201 duties from June 26, 2024, to September 23, 2024, provided the contract terms have not changed.

    How much does a bifacial solar system cost?

    With the removal of this exemption, the cost of imported bifacial solar panels, typically ranging from $0.10-0.25 per watt, will increase by $0.015 to $0.0375 per watt. For commercial projects with installation costs between $1.50 and $2.75 per watt, these increases will result in system price hikes of about 1-2%.

  • How many watts are 3000v solar panels

    How many watts are 3000v solar panels

    The calculation looks simple enough. If your inverter needs 3000 watts, get ten 300 watt solar panels. 10 x 300 = 3000 watts an hour right? Well it is not that simple. A 300 watt solar panel kit – we highly rec.


    FAQs about How many watts are 3000v solar panels

    How many solar panels would a 3000 watt inverter run?

    If you need to run a lot of AC powered loads, a 3000 watt inverter can get the job done. These have become more affordable lately, but how many solar panels would you need to run a full power load? A 3000 watt inverter needs twelve 300 watt solar panels to run at maximum capacity.

    How much power can a 300 watt solar panel produce?

    If you have a 300 watt solar panel, it can generate approximately 1.22 kWh per day or 438 kWh per year. These figures depend on the irradiance of your area, the efficiency of your power inverter, and your panel's voltage and current. The maximum power a solar panel can produce depends on the panel's voltage and current, which are optimally matched.

    How many appliances can a 3000 watt inverter run?

    A 3000 watt inverter can run several appliances, but it is only as effective as its energy source. A combination of at least 12 x 300 watt solar panels and a large battery bank will suffice. With this you can expect your appliances to run smoothly. I am an advocate of solar power.

    How many watts can a 12 x 300 watt solar array produce?

    A 12 x 300W solar array can give you 3480 watts an hour. Even if the solar panels never reach 300 watts, the output is still higher than the inverter requirement. Even if your inverter is 90% efficient, there is still enough power to meet the demand.

    How many solar panels do I Need?

    If you are using only 300-watt solar panels, you will need 17 300-watt solar panels for a 5kW solar system (17 × 300 watts is actually 5100 watts, so this is a 5.1kW system). If you are using only 400-watt solar panels, you will need 13 400-watt solar panels for a 5kW solar system (13 × 400 watts is actually 5200 watts, so this is a 5.2kW system).

    How many solar panels do you need for a 3KW system?

    Number Of Panels (3kW System, 300-Watt Panels) = (3kW × 1000) / 300W = 10 300-Watt Solar Panels You can see that you need 10 300-watt solar panels to construct a 3kW solar system. If you don't get the full number of solar panels (you get 15.67, for example), just round it up (to 16 in this case).
